Recognizing gender dysphoria and recovery in trans/trans interactions

If you have heard about the term
gender dysphoria
however certain just what it indicates — and on occasion even if you have never ever heard about it — we have you covered! From the American Psychiatry Association, sex dysphoria is defined as, “scientifically considerable worry or impairment regarding a substantial need to be of another gender, which could integrate desire to transform main and/or secondary gender qualities.”.


In simpler terms and conditions, sex dysphoria trigger stress for several trans people if particular areas of the body don’t align using their gender identification.

As an example, a transgender lady may go through gender dysphoria if she has male parts of the body.

Medically transitioning and undergoing surgeries can alleviate if not pull gender dysphoria, but it is important to realize that only a few transgender folks feel gender dysphoria. However, itis also crucial that you be familiar with the mental health effects for people that have a problem with gender dysphoria, especially if they do not possess resources to simply help align on their own a lot more directly their sex identification.

In trans/trans interactions, gender dysphoria is already fully understood between both trans men and women. Absolutely even a chance that matchmaking another trans individual can deal with feelings of dysphoria because you are not viewed as just a trans individual among cisgender men and women.

How to make matchmaking between two transgender people function

For cisgender individuals who are internet dating a transgender person, advice for steps to make their unique commitment work consists of avoiding microaggressions, but what about trans/trans connections? Can there be also
problems
?

Most of the same advice can certainly still implement.

Including, microaggressions can certainly still originate from a trans person.

Although it are less likely to want to come from some body that already understands exactly what it’s prefer to live as a trans individual, that does not mean that an inappropriate opinion or question might not come from them.


From your list above that pointed out benefits associated with online dating another trans individual, one thing to consider is that your lover cannot wish advice about sex appearance recommendations.

Also, no matter if the trans spouse determines with similar gender whenever, they might promote themselves differently. It is critical to just remember that , each person is exclusive and you are also allowed to carve your very own identity.

Something that Kelvin Sparks pointed out inside the post is actually exactly how he’d some trans associates in earlier times that tried to stress him out of looking for base surgical procedure. What somebody would like to do with regards to body is a personal choice, and that can actually a necessity regarding gender affirming surgery.


If you should be online dating another trans individual, you will want to accept them for who they really are, though they’ve been nonetheless in the process of transitioning.

Winning trans connections​

Since trans/trans intimate relationships aren’t talked about adequate, we will highlight a couple of lovers that demonstrate these connections perform occur.

Precious and Myles Brady-Davis

The pair met whenever valuable, a trans lady, ended up being operating at an LGBTQ youthfulness middle in Chicago and joined an union whenever Precious’ friend inspired them to carry on a night out together. Myles, a trans man, told Precious that he wanted to have young children together with her.

They certainly were just a little uncertain about parenthood as a trans pair, but all of all of them chose to briefly prevent hormonal treatment options to offer all of them top chance due to their fertility. After two years, Myles turned into expecting through IVF and decided to happily carry on riding the bus working in place of hire ride services.

In December 2019, their own daughter Zayn was created which turned into an initial your condition of Illinois as she was born to a couple of transgender parents.

Katie Hill and Arin Andrews

This few was actually called one honestly transgender adolescent couple in america a few in years past. They met both in 2012 while dealing with their unique transition. They published movies discussing their own quest of transitioning with each other therefore the highs and lows of their union. Unfortuitously, they presumably have now concluded their own relationship, but Kate and Arin state they continue to have an unique connection together.
